i got 10355 in kee and i belong EZ category.in which all colleges i will get admssion for btech(govt or aided)for EE?wat r the scopes about that stream?
Posted by Vipin, kannur On 31.05.2010
View Answer
Candidates with this rank did not get allotment for EE in EZ category in 2009 in Govt /Aided Colleges. You may give options and see.
Job prospects for Electrical Engineers are mostly in the State Electricity Boards, private power supply companies, and electrical machine-manufacturing units. Every large industry requires the services of electrical engineers

My Medical Rank No. is 2152. i have any chance to get admission for MBBS in Merit Seat.
Can you please explain the possibilities for getting admission for MBBS in Kerala.
Posted by Farooq S Hameed, Varkala On 31.05.2010
View Answer
In 2009 candidates with this rank did not get allotment for MBBS in Govt Medical Colleges or in Govt quota in Govt SF or Private SF Medical Colleges under State Merit. However, candidates with this rank got allotment under Management quota at CMC Cochi. Things can be different this year. Give options and see.
